> On Dec 4, 2013, at 10:29, "Hoyt, Mike" <mike.h...@impgroup.com> wrote: > > Steve > > Call them. There likely is a process where you can take some time to pay. I > once received a letter from CRA giving me 30 days to pay $18000. I called > and they were able to extend it up to one year. Letters from CRA demanding > payment do not make you feel very nice. Would not want to wish that on > anyone. > > ... and yes. Pretty much everyone on this list knows that sales tax is due > on purchase of a boat in their own province if that rule applies. I know > that many on private sale get away with not doing it but when you licenese > the boat you start a paper trail where it should be paid. So basically only > unlicensed boats or boats with less than 10 horsepower get away with it. > > The good news is that our boats are really cheap to buy.
